MAN delivers 200th Truck to Go

Haulage firm’s order marks milestone in MAN Truck & Bus UK sales programme.

G Moore Haulage, based in Kempston Hardwick, Bedfordshire, is taking delivery of its seventh MAN TGM18.250 with HYVA skip loader body and HYVA sheeting system, all fitted by Thompsons (UK) Ltd at their Blackburn factory.

The vehicles have been supplied under the MAN Trucks To Go scheme (TTG), which significantly reduces lead times for customers and cuts the need to wait for a factory build slot for their vehicle.

MAN TTG representative Neil Stoddart said: “This order brought us our 200th sale under the scheme for 2014 and clearly highlights the convenience and benefits of the programme, where vehicles are ready to go straight away to meet customer demand.”

MAN Salesman Scott Munton explained: “With MAN Trucks To Go, we offer our customers an extensive stock of ready new vehicles. Most modern transport solutions are available, from the construction, heavy-duty transport, municipal, long-haul and distribution transport sectors.

“In this instance we caught the vehicles mid-build and were able to personalise them to G Moore’s specification.”

Company owner Glen Moore said: “We will have eight MANs in our fleet when this order is completed and we hope this will be the start of a continued relationship with MAN. We have an excellent contacts with the local dealership, John Arnold Commercials, too. The service was second to none.

“The vehicles are lighter than our previous fleet and have given us a greater payload which we appreciate.”

Scott added: “The competitive deal and the three year warranty helped seal the deal with the company and we hope to be able to do business again in the near future.”
